第1章绪论

ARM处理器的发展书1.1~1.2-随堂测验

1、单选题:
‏以下不是ARM含义的是()。‍‏‍
选项:
A: 一种高级RISC技术
B: 一个高级RISC(精简指令集)处理器的公司
C: 一种高级编程语言
D: 一类采用高级RISC的处理器
答案: 【 一种高级编程语言

2、多选题:
‌ARM支持的OS类型()。​
选项:
A: WinCE
B: iOS
C: Linux(Android)
D: Symbian
答案: 【 WinCE;
iOS;
Linux(Android);
Symbian

3、判断题:
‏ARM(Advanced RISC Machines),既是一个公司的名字,也是对一类微处理器的通称,还可以认为是一种技术名称。‍‏‍
选项:
A: 正确
B: 错误
答案: 【 正确

ARM处理器的特点及应用书1.3-随堂测验

1、多选题:
‍下列属于ARM微处理器的实际应用的有()。​‍​
选项:
A: 工业控制领域
B: A. 无线通讯领域
C: 网络应用
D: 电子类产品
答案: 【 工业控制领域;
A. 无线通讯领域;
网络应用;
电子类产品

2、多选题:
​下列关于ARM微处理器的说法正确的有()。​​​
选项:
A: 采用定点CISC 处理器
B: 性能高、体积小、能耗小、成本低
C: 支持Thumb(16 位)/ARM(32 位)双指令集,能很好的兼容8位/16位器件
D: 增强性乘法器设计,支持实时(real-time)调试
答案: 【 性能高、体积小、能耗小、成本低;
支持Thumb(16 位)/ARM(32 位)双指令集,能很好的兼容8位/16位器件;
增强性乘法器设计,支持实时(real-time)调试

3、判断题:
​‎​CISC的英文全称为“Reduced Instruction Set Computing”,中文即“精简指令集”,它的指令系统相对简单,它只要求硬件执行很有限且最常用的那部分指令,大部分复杂的操作则使用成熟的编译技术,由简单指令合成。‎​‎
选项:
A: 正确
B: 错误
答案: 【 错误

4、填空题:
​RISC的英文全称为“Reduced Instruction Set Computing”,中文即     ,它的指令系统相对简单,它只要求硬件执行很有限且最常用的那部分指令,大部分复杂的操作则使用成熟的编译技术,由简单指令合成。‌​‌
答案: 【 精简指令集

ARM微处理器系列书1.4~1.5-随堂测验

1、单选题:
‏以下不属于ARM微处理器系列的是()。‌‏‌
选项:
A: ARM7系列微处理器
B: ARM8系列微处理器
C: ARM9系列微处理器
D: ARM9E系列微处理器
答案: 【 ARM8系列微处理器

2、单选题:
‏对ARM-Cortex系列处理器来说,错误的说法是()。​‏​
选项:
A:  Cortex-A为应用处理器
B: Cortex-M为微控制器系列
C: Cortex-R为实时处理器
D:  Cortex-R不为实时处理器
答案: 【  Cortex-R不为实时处理器

3、单选题:
‎最新的Cortex内核包含多个系列,以下哪个不属于cortex内核系列()。‌‎‌
选项:
A: A系列
B: R系列
C: M系列
D: H系列
答案: 【 H系列

4、判断题:
​ARM Cortex系列是经典处理器ARM10以后产品的新的命名系列,只在为各种不同的市场提供服务,采用的是ARMv7体系结构。‎​‎
选项:
A: 正确
B: 错误
答案: 【 错误

5、填空题:
ARM7属于  结构。‎‍‎
答案: 【 冯诺依曼##%_YZPRLFH_%##冯.诺依曼

6、填空题:
‎ARM7属于   级流水线。‎‎‎
答案: 【 3

7、填空题:
‏ARM9属于   级流水线。‏
答案: 【 5

8、填空题:
‍ARM9属于  结构。‍
答案: 【 哈佛

第一单元测试

1、单选题:
‌微处理器的基本组成部分有:寄存器堆、()、时序控制电路,以及数据和地址总线。​‌​
选项:
A: 加法器
B: 乘法器
C: 运算器
D: 移位控制器
答案: 【 运算器

2、单选题:
‌下列哪项不是ARM(Advanced RISC Machines)的特点?‌‌‌
选项:
A: 一个公司的名字
B: 一类微处理器的通称
C: 一个人的名字
D: 一种技术名称
答案: 【 一个人的名字

3、单选题:
‌ARM(Advanced RISC Machines)公司‏‌于1990年成立于()。‏‌‏
选项:
A: 美国哈弗
B: 英国牛津
C: 美国斯坦福大学
D: 英国剑桥
答案: 【 英国剑桥

4、单选题:
​1979年()提出了RISC(Reduced Instruction Set Computer,精简指令集计算机)的概念。‎​‎
选项:
A: 美国哈弗大学
B: 美国加州大学伯克利分校
C: 英国牛津大学
D: 英国剑桥大学
答案: 【 美国加州大学伯克利分校

5、单选题:
‏ARM7 系列微处理器为低功耗的()位RISC处理器,小型、快速、低能耗、集成式RISC内核,用于移动通信。‏‏‏
选项:
A: 16
B: 32
C: 8
D: 64
答案: 【 32

6、单选题:
‍针对运行实时操作系统进行控制应用的系统,是cortex 哪个系列()?‍‍‍
选项:
A: Cortex-A
B: Cortex-M
C: Cortex-R
D: Cortex-N
答案: 【 Cortex-R

7、单选题:
‍为对开发费用非常敏感,同时对性能要求不断增加的微控制器应用所设计的是哪个系列()?‎‍‎
选项:
A: Cortex-A
B: Cortex-R
C: Cortex-M
D: Cortex-N
答案: 【 Cortex-M

8、单选题:
​为了增强多任务处理能力、数学运算能力、多媒体以及网络处理能力,ARM芯片内置多个芯核,目前常见的结构不包括()。‍​‍​‍
选项:
A: ARM+DSP
B: ARM+FPGA
C: ARM+PLC
D: ARM+ARM
答案: 【 ARM+PLC

9、判断题:
‌传统的中央处理器与微处理器相比,传统的中央处理器具有体积小,重量轻和容易模块化等优点。​‌​
选项:
A: 正确
B: 错误
答案: 【 错误

10、判断题:
‎ARM公司是专门从事基于RISC技术芯片设计开发的公司。‏‎‏
选项:
A: 正确
B: 错误
答案: 【 正确

11、判断题:
‌ARM片内指令和数据高速缓冲器容量增大,大多数数据操作都在存储器中完成。‍‌‍
选项:
A: 正确
B: 错误
答案: 【 错误

12、判断题:
‎ARM采用标准总线接口,为外设提供统一的地址和数据总线。‎
选项:
A: 正确
B: 错误
答案: 【 正确

13、判断题:
‍在CISC 指令集的各种指令中,使用频率却相差悬殊,大约有80%的指令会被反复使用,占整个程序代码的20%。‏‍‏
选项:
A: 正确
B: 错误
答案: 【 错误

14、判断题:
‏RISC结构优先选取使用频最低的简单指令,避免复杂指令。‍‏‍
选项:
A: 正确
B: 错误
答案: 【 错误

15、判断题:
‏RISC的英文全称为“Reduced Instruction Set Computing”,中文即“精简指令集”,它的指令系统相对简单,它只要求硬件执行很有限且最常用的那部分指令,大部分复杂的操作则使用成熟的编译技术,由简单指令合成。‎‏‎
选项:
A: 正确
B: 错误
答案: 【 正确

16、判断题:
‌到目前为止,ARM 微处理器及技术的应用几乎已经深入到各个领域:工业控制领域、无线通讯领域、网络应用、消费类电子产品、成像和安全产品。​‌​
选项:
A: 正确
B: 错误
答案: 【 正确

17、判断题:
‍ARM Cortex系列是经典处理器ARM11以后产品的新的命名系列,只在为各种不同的市场提供服务,采用的是‌‍ARMv7体系结构。‌‍‌
选项:
A: 正确
B: 错误
答案: 【 正确

18、判断题:
‏Cortex-A系列:基于ARMv7A,针对日益增长的、运行包括Linux、Windows CE、Symbian和Android操作系统在内的消费娱乐和无线产品。‏‏‏
选项:
A: 正确
B: 错误
答案: 【 正确

19、判断题:
‎RISC结构优先选取使用频最高的简单指令,将指令长度不固定。‍‎‍
选项:
A: 正确
B: 错误
答案: 【 错误

20、判断题:
​RISC并非只是简单地去减少指令,而是把着眼点放在了如何使计算机的结构更加简单合理地提高运算速度上。‎​‎
选项:
A: 正确
B: 错误
答案: 【 正确

第2章ARMCortex-M4核体系结构

ARM体系结构书2.1-随堂测验

1、单选题:
‏下面关于哈佛结构描述正确的是()‍‏‍
选项:
A: 程序存储空间与数据存储空间分离
B: 存储空间与IO空间分离
C: 程序存储空间与数据存储空间合并
D: 存储空间与IO空间合并
答案: 【 程序存储空间与数据存储空间分离

2、单选题:
‌指令和数据共享同一总线的体系结构是()‌‌‌
选项:
A: 冯•诺依曼结构
B: 哈佛结构
C: RISC
D: CISC
答案: 【 冯•诺依曼结构

3、多选题:
​‏​下列组成Cortex-M4处理器内核的三级流水线架构的是()‏​‏​‏
选项:
A: 取址
B: 译码
C: 编码
D: 执行
答案: 【 取址;
译码;
执行

ARM处理器工作原理书2.2-随堂测验

1、单选题:
​通常所说的 32 位微处理器是指()。‍​‍
选项:
A: 地址总线的宽度为 32 位
B: 处理的数据长度只能为 32 位
C: CPU 字长为 32 位
D: 通用寄存器数目为 32 个
答案: 【 CPU 字长为 32 位

2、单选题:
​ARM指令集和Thumb指令集分别是()。​​​
选项:
A: 8位,16位
B: 16位,32位
C: 16位,16位
D: 32位,16位
答案: 【 32位,16位

3、判断题:
​ARM微处理器的运行模式可以通过硬件改变。‍​‍
选项:
A: 正确
B: 错误
答案: 【 错误

4、判断题:
‍Cortex-M处理器支持ARM指令集。​‍​
选项:
A: 正确
B: 错误
答案: 【 错误

5、判断题:
‎默认情况下,Cortex-M4处理器启动时处于线程模式和Thumb状态。‏‎‏
选项:
A: 正确
B: 错误
答案: 【 正确

Cortex-M4存储器系统书2.6~2.7-随堂测验

1、单选题:
‎嵌入式系统最常用的数据传输方式()。‏
选项:
A: 中断
B: 查询
C: DMA 
D: IO机
答案: 【 中断

2、多选题:
​Cortex-M4系统的地址映射图分为()‏​‏
选项:
A: Code区、SRAM区
B: Peripheral区、RAM区
C: Devices区、System区
D: Bit-Band区
答案: 【 Code区、SRAM区;
Peripheral区、RAM区;
Devices区、System区

3、多选题:
‌Cortex-M4处理器的4GB空间被划分为多个存储区域,由于这一划分是基于典型的用法,所以不同的区域主要被设计成以下用途()。‏‌‏
选项:
A: 程序代码访问
B: 数据访问
C: 外设
D: 编译
答案: 【 程序代码访问;
数据访问;
外设

4、判断题:
‌几乎所有的微控制器中都不支持中断,中断通常由硬件电路产生,不会改变处理器执行程序的顺序。‏‌‏
选项:
A: 正确
B: 错误
答案: 【 错误

5、判断题:
‏大多数异常IRQ由

剩余75%内容付费后可查看

发表评论

电子邮件地址不会被公开。 必填项已用*标注